Start with 2.5mg to 5mg of THC. That’s the range most first-timers and regular users prefer, and it’s backed by sales data showing 42% of edible consumers stick with 10mg or less per serving.
Edibles hit differently than smoking. They take longer to kick in—usually 30 minutes to two hours—and the effects last longer, sometimes four to six hours. If you take too much too fast, you’re stuck riding it out.
Take one low-dose gummy or piece, then wait at least two hours before considering more. It’s easy to assume nothing’s happening and double up, but that’s how people end up uncomfortable. You can always take more next time. You can’t untake what you’ve already eaten.
Cash on delivery is the standard. Most cannabis dispensaries in New York can’t process credit or debit cards because cannabis is still federally illegal, which makes banks nervous about handling those transactions.
Some dispensaries are starting to offer payment apps or cashless ATM systems, but those aren’t widespread yet. For now, plan to have cash ready when the driver arrives.
If you’re ordering something over $100 and don’t want to carry that much cash, you can ask about splitting the order into two deliveries or check if the dispensary offers any alternative payment options. It’s worth asking when you place the order.

Yes. CBD edibles are part of the selection, and they won’t get you high. They’re popular with people using cannabis for wellness reasons—better sleep, stress relief, chronic pain management—without the psychoactive effects of THC.
CBD products have seen about 25% growth recently as more people explore cannabis for health benefits. You’ll find CBD gummies, chocolates, and drinks that contain little to no THC, usually less than 0.3% to stay within legal limits.
If you want a mix, there are also products with balanced ratios of CBD and THC. Those give you some of the calming effects of CBD with a mild high from the THC. Check the product details before ordering so you know exactly what you’re getting.
